What is the cheapest month to fly to Denver?

To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for flights to Denver,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.

The cheapest month for flights to Denver is February, where tickets cost $699 on average for one-way flights. On the other hand, the most expensive months are July and December, where the average cost of tickets from Germany is $1,015 and $985 respectively. For return trips, the best month to travel is March with an average price of $731.

What is a good deal for flights to Denver?

If you’re looking for cheap airfare to Denver, 25% of our users found tickets to Denver for the following prices or less: From Munich $786 one-way - $843 round-trip, from Frankfurt am Main Airport $794 one-way - $785 round-trip.

How far in advance should I book a flight to Denver?

To calculate weekly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each week before departure over the last year for round-trip flights to Denver,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the average of all the values for each week.

To get a below average price, you should book around 1 week before departure. For the absolute cheapest price, our data suggests you should book 29 days before departure.

FAQs - booking Denver flights

  • How far is Denver Intl Airport from central Denver?

    Central Denver is 18 miles away from Denver Intl Airport.

  • What is the name of Denver’s airport?

    When flying to Denver, you'll arrive at Denver Intl Airport (DEN). The airport is also known as Denver or Denver Intl.

  • How much is a flight to Denver?

    On average, a flight to Denver costs $938. The cheapest price found on KAYAK in the last 2 weeks cost $680 and departed from Frankfurt am Main Airport.

  • What is the cheapest day to fly to Denver?

    Based on KAYAK data, the cheapest day to fly to Denver is Tuesday where tickets can be as cheap as $806. On the other hand, the most expensive day to fly is Saturday, where prices are $995 on average.
